Two movies titled Frozen enter, only one will leave (with its title) as Herman Davis, Andrea Vickery, Zach Vickery, and Robert Rau watch Herman’s favorite musical and a “Ewwww, nononononono” horror film to determine which movie is Frozen.
All four participants had already seen the Disney film — some of them more than 30 times — while no one had seen the horror movie. So in preparation for Herman’s sing-a-long, we watched the 2010 horror movie filled with bad decisions and unlikable stars. Not only are these three people just awful, it’s hard to believe how they managed to live as long as they had in the first place. Frozen(2010) does have the advantage of being incredibly gross, so much so Robert left the room several times to think happy thoughts.
Good thing Disney movies are great at washing unpleasantness right out of your head. Both movies do feature snow and people suffering from hypothermia, but Disney does have the advantage of someone actually freezing. Will that be enough for the Disney film to keep the title? Listen if you dare.
